Navigation Rules and Operator Responsibilities
Ferry operators in New York waters must follow strict navigation rules set by the U.S. Coast Guard and state maritime authorities. These rules cover speed limits, right-of-way, and mandatory reporting of near misses. Adherence is essential to prevent collisions in congested channels where commercial traffic, tour boats, and commuter ferries intersect.
Human factors such as fatigue, distraction, and inadequate training can compromise compliance. When operators fail to maintain proper lookout or misread radar and AIS data, the risk of a ferry accident in New York rises sharply. Continuous drills, updated simulators, and strict roster management help mitigate these dangers.
Mechanical Failure and Emergency Response
Mechanical failure remains a leading contributor to ferry accidents in New York, especially in aging vessels or those lacking rigorous maintenance schedules. Steering loss, engine shutdown, or electrical faults can strand passengers in open water and delay rescue operations. Response time is critical, and crews must coordinate with harbor tugs and emergency services.
Documentation of maintenance records, onboard spare parts, and real-time diagnostics plays a vital role in determining incident cause. Regulators review these logs closely to decide whether lapses in upkeep or manufacturer defects bear responsibility. Passengers rely on transparent communication from operators during such emergencies.
Weather, Wake, and Environmental Hazards
Sudden changes in weather, including fog, strong crosswinds, and squalls, create hazardous conditions on New York waterways. A ferry accident in New York can be triggered when high waves and reduced visibility challenge vessel stability. Operators are trained to adjust speed, alter routes, or suspend service when conditions worsen beyond safe limits.
Wake from larger commercial ships and construction activity also threatens smaller passenger vessels. Wake-induced capsizing has led to severe injuries, highlighting the need for enforced speed zones and real-time monitoring. Environmental agencies work with ferry companies to map safe corridors and seasonal restrictions.
Safety Investigations and Policy Changes
After a ferry accident in New York, federal and state agencies conduct thorough investigations to identify systemic weaknesses. Their findings often lead to updated regulations, enhanced crew training, and infrastructure improvements at terminals. Public pressure and media coverage accelerate these reforms, pushing for stronger oversight.
Investment in modern navigation systems, updated lifesaving equipment, and clearer emergency signage shows measurable progress. However, gaps remain in coordination between multiple agencies, which can slow implementation. Consistent funding and political will are essential to sustain long-term safety gains.
